Malta import shipments of programmable application specific integrated circuits (ASIC) saw a significant boost in 2024, with top exporting countries being Metropolitan France, Italy, Germany, Japan, and China. The market concentration, measured by the Herfindahl-Hirschman Index (HHI), remained very high, indicating a strong dominance of these key players. The compound annual growth rate (CAGR) for the period 2020-24 was an impressive 74.22%, with a notable growth rate of 8.7% from 2023 to 2024. This data suggests a robust and dynamic market for programmable ASICs in Malta, driven by key importing partners and sustained growth momentum.
